A translation-invariant renormalizable non-commutative scalar model
R. Gurau, J. Magnen, V. Rivasseau, A. Tanasa

Abstract
In this paper we propose a translation-invariant scalar model on the Moyal space. We prove that this model does not suffer from the UV/IR mixing and we establish its renormalizability to all orders in perturbation theory.
